The GOMX-2 nanosatellite is for the following months on display at the Science Centre Singapore. GOMX-2 carries a quantum light source built by the Centre for Quantum Technologies (CQT), NUS. During its 2014 launch, the rocket exploded just after take-off. But this GOMX-2 survived, remarkably, still fully functional. Associate Prof. Alexander Ling and Associate Director Jenny Hogan, Outreach and Media Relations, CQT, at National University of Singapore posing with the satellite.
